NHL Division Primer: The Atlantic

The Atlantic Division has been filled with your usual slew of free agent signings, RFA commitments, trades and other headline worthy moves. Detroit attempted to address their depth and injury concerns, while Toronto made the biggest move in trading Phil Kessel to Pittsburgh on July 1. Boston certainly "made some moves" and are apparently "not re-building." Ok, sure.

While the Montreal Canadiens held off the Tampa Bay Lightning for the division crown last year, it took Vezina-winner Carey Price to do so. If they can get a similar performance from Price in 2015-16, they will certainly contend for the crown again.
